Hard Times For Everybody

To the Editor:

I just read the article concerning the large supporter showing for the upcoming school budget proposal [“Teachers, School Supporters Dominate Budget Hearing,” page 1, 2/27/09]. I have to say I was not surprised when I read the comment made by Newtown teacher Trisha McCoy, “When you cut my salary, you’re cutting my family’s salary.” I think we have gotten to the real reason for the push for more and more money.

Ms McCoy wants to maintain her current salary and is asking the taxpayers to see that she continues to do so. I didn’t hear anything about how the children will suffer or how property values will go down or even how the ranking of Newtown schools will decrease. These are hard times for everybody. My business has gone down, my daughter lost her job and can’t sell their house. Everybody is in the same boat. I don’t think any body should be immune from budget cuts. We all have to share in this together.

As for the school budget, I won’t vote Yes for anything more than a zero percent increase. Your budgets are driving out the people who impact the town the least — senior citizens. The good times stopped rolling a while ago and it’s about time the school board came to grips with that.
